The Problem
A commercial building in Addis, LA had damaged gutters, which were also overrun with plants and debris caught in them. This leaves them useless, unpleasant to see, and a risk for damages and hefty expenses later on.

The old gutters on the building were filled to the brim with leaves, growing plants, and other debris—blocking proper water flow within the gutters. Left unchecked, this issue could cause serious damage to the building.
The Solution
To combat the problem, we first removed the old gutters from the building, and cleaned off the remaining debris left on the edge of the roof.
The next course of action was to replace the old gutters and install new seamless gutters. These seamless gutters not only look better than the old, but are also functional and protect the building from water damage.

To prevent further issues with stuck debris and to keep the plants from growing in the gutters again, our team added leaf guards to the seamless gutters.

These features improved both the building’s curb appeal and protection.
